New Member Registrations

By Michael Parkin

Information on how to register as a Parent Member and pay Annual Junior Membership on-line.

If you are new to Pitchero the first step is to go through the registration process and apply for applicable roles in the club. As a parent it is essential that you apply for the role of 'Parent' but please feel free to also add club supporter and club member too.

Those who have already registered on Pitchero, you can manage your club membership and apply for the role of Parent.

Once you are in the parent registration section, you will be given the option to select all the teams that apply to you and then you will be asked to add your child. As you are typing their name a box will appear underneath where you are typing with the following: "Cant find the member you're looking for? click here to add a new member". Click this and you will be taken to the registration form for your child.

Please take time to fill in this registration form as accurately as possible as it is essential that each coach in charge of the group has the correct contact details at hand and that they have all the necessary medical information should your child require treatment.

For the code of conduct, please take time to read the Parent/Guardian Code of Conduct and ensure that your child is aware of the contents of the Player Code of Conduct. (see below).

Once you have completed the form (and agreed to the code of conduct), you can repeat the process for each of your children then select 'Apply'. At this point the webmaster will check over your application, approve it and assign the Junior Membership to each of your kids. You will receive an email confirming your application has been successful and at this point you can go to the payment section of the club homepage and pay the membership (please ensure that you have tagged your child on the payment). You currently have to go through this process separately for each child and the payment is in the form of a one off direct debit.

The information you provide for membership for both you and your child(ren), is not available to other members and treated in the strictest confidence. If there are any issues you would like to discuss separately from the form, please contact the secretary at secretary@huntlyrfc.com
